In a nutshell, parasites are organisms that grow, feed and live on or in other living organisms, known as “hosts.” Parasites can be split into 2 groups, protozoa (one-celled organisms) and the other helminths (worms).
When organisms of different species closely mix with each another, they are involved in a symbiotic relationship, in which at least one organism must benefit as a result of the relationship.
There are many types of symbiotic relationships that we view with between interacting organisms, they include mutualism, commensalism and parasitism. A mutualistic symbiotic relationship is beneficial for both organisms.
Once such instance to explain the above the amazing relationship between bees and flowers. Flowers are pollinated by bees, which use pollen to make delicious honey. We can see from the above that both the bee and flow benefit from this symbiotic relationship.
If we look at a commensal relationship on the other hand, this is when one organism benefits and the other is unaffected. A great natural example to showcase this is the relationship between tress and birds. Birds use trees to build nests and take shelter etc but the tree is not harmed and it gains not benefit in any way.
Lastly, in a parasitic relationship only one organism takes benefits but the other organism takes harm. If we look at dogs and ticks as example, we can see that the tick only benefits as it gains the blood of the dog. The dog however can suffer from anemia when it loses its blood.
Parasites can be transmitted from animal to animal, animal to man, and in some cases, man to animal. Some parasites are larger than viruses and bacteria, but they are usually so small that you cannot see them without a microscope.
Worms can grow quite large and can be seen with our eyes. Parasites live within the organs and tissues of the body can cause harm if not treated. Any number of them can infect your gastrointestinal tract. Eventually, they are removed in the feces.
